Frogs have adapted to survive in diverse and extreme environments worldwide. From the cold winters of North America to the dry deserts of South Africa, frogs like the northern leopard frog and desert rain frog have developed unique strategies for survival. Saddleback toads thrive in cloud forests, while scrotum frogs are fully aquatic, living in low-oxygen waters. The recently discovered ladderite frogs inhabit rocky wastelands in India. These adaptations highlight the resilience and evolutionary success of frogs over millions of years.
